Advertisement

Python项目实践:基于PyQt5、百度智能云及OpenCV的AI人脸识别考勤系统(附SQLite3).pdf

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本PDF详细介绍了一个结合PyQt5界面设计、百度智能云服务和OpenCV图像处理技术的人脸识别考勤系统的开发流程,同时利用SQLite3进行数据管理。适合希望深入学习Python项目实践的读者阅读。 Python项目开发实战:AI人脸识别签到打卡系统(PyQt5+百度智能云+OpenCV-Python+SQLite3),编程案例实例教程。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• PythonPyQt5OpenCVAISQLite3).pdf
    优质
    本PDF详细介绍了一个结合PyQt5界面设计、百度智能云服务和OpenCV图像处理技术的人脸识别考勤系统的开发流程,同时利用SQLite3进行数据管理。适合希望深入学习Python项目实践的读者阅读。 Python项目开发实战:AI人脸识别签到打卡系统(PyQt5+百度智能云+OpenCV-Python+SQLite3),编程案例实例教程。
  • 设计与现.pdf
    优质
    本文档详细探讨并实现了基于百度人工智能技术的人脸识别考勤系统的开发过程,涵盖系统架构、关键技术及应用效果分析。 《基于百度AI人脸识别的考勤系统设计与实现》一文详细介绍了如何利用百度的人工智能技术开发一套高效准确的考勤管理系统。该文章首先概述了当前考勤管理系统的不足之处,然后阐述了采用先进的人脸识别技术解决这些问题的优势和可行性。文中还深入探讨了基于百度AI平台构建人脸识别模型的具体步骤和技术细节,并对系统的设计理念、架构以及实现方法进行了全面解析。 此外,作者还分享了一些关键的技术挑战及其解决方案,包括如何提高人脸识别的准确率与速度、确保系统的稳定性及安全性等重要议题。最后,文章通过实际案例展示了这套考勤系统的应用效果和潜在价值,在一定程度上验证了其在企业办公场景中的实用性和推广前景。
  • PythonOpenCV.zip
    优质
    本项目为一个基于Python语言与OpenCV库开发的人脸识别考勤系统,能够实现自动人脸检测、身份验证及出勤记录管理功能。 Python结合OpenCV开发的人脸识别签到考勤系统具备以下功能:1. 通过人脸识别完成员工的签到或签退;2. 计算并记录每位员工的考勤时间;3. 将考勤数据保存为CSV格式,便于在Excel中查看和管理。
  • AIQT打卡C++.zip
    优质
    本项目是一款基于百度人工智能技术的人脸识别考勤系统,采用C++编程实现,旨在提高办公效率和安全性。通过集成百度AI平台SDK,实现了员工快速准确的面部签到功能,适用于企业内部管理需求。 实习C++项目:基于百度AI的QT人脸考勤打卡系统.zip 这个描述似乎只是文件名或项目的标题重复了多次。如果你需要更详细的信息或者希望我根据此名称来构建一个简短的项目介绍,请提供更多的细节要求,例如项目的功能、技术栈等具体信息。
  • Python战:OpenCV员工
    优质
    本项目介绍如何运用Python结合OpenCV开发一套高效的人脸识别考勤系统,实现对员工的智能化管理和考勤记录。 该程序包含项目全部代码,能够实现员工信息的增删改查功能,并能判断员工上下班是否迟到或早退。此外还提供了一个管理员账号以方便管理操作员的信息。无需额外数据库支持,使用文本段落件存储数据即可。 下载后,请注意修改文件名,不建议使用含有中文字符的名称。
  • OpenCVAI界面(PyQt5
    优质
    本项目运用Python编程语言和PyQt5框架开发了一个用户友好的图形界面,结合OpenCV库实现高效精准的目标识别及人脸识别功能。 目标识别是计算机视觉领域的一个重要组成部分,它涉及从图像或视频流中检测并定位感兴趣的目标对象,并对其进行分类。OpenCV(开源计算机视觉库)是一个强大的工具包,提供了大量函数用于实现各种计算机视觉任务,包括但不限于目标识别、特征检测和提取、图像处理等。通过使用OpenCV中的相关算法和技术,开发者能够高效地完成复杂的目标识别项目。
  • Android Studio和学生设计
    优质
    本项目旨在开发一款基于Android Studio和百度智能云技术的学生人脸识别考勤系统,以提高校园管理效率与准确性。通过集成先进的人脸识别算法,该应用能够自动记录学生的出勤情况,并提供便捷的数据查询功能,助力学校实现智能化的日常运营。 基于安卓开发一个学生人脸识别课程考勤签到系统,主要是为了方便学校老师统计自己上课的考勤情况。老师可以注册自己的账号,并通过web端登录后添加和管理学生信息。每个学生的记录中包括了人脸图像,在添加过程中需要录入相应的人脸数据。
  • PythonOpenCV签到.zip
    优质
    本项目为一个基于Python语言与OpenCV库开发的人脸识别签到考勤解决方案。通过面部特征捕捉及匹配技术实现自动化、高效的员工出勤记录管理,提升办公效率和安全性。包含源代码和相关资源的压缩包便于下载安装使用。 在本项目中开发的人脸识别签到考勤系统是基于Python编程语言与OpenCV库构建的智能解决方案。作为图像处理及计算机视觉领域的强大工具,OpenCV提供了丰富的功能来实时分析、处理并识别人脸。 该项目的核心技术包括: 1. **人脸识别**:此过程涉及人脸检测和人脸识别两个步骤。通过使用预训练模型Haar级联分类器进行快速的人脸定位;而Eigenfaces、Fisherfaces或LBPH等算法则被用于将面部特征转换为向量,以便进行比对。 2. **Python编程**:该项目的开发环境依赖于Python语言的强大功能和简洁语法。它可能利用了PIL(现称为Pillow)处理图像,并使用Numpy库来进行数值计算与数据管理。 3. **图像预处理**:在执行人脸识别前,通常需要先对输入图片进行灰度化、归一化及直方图均衡等操作,以提升识别精度。 4. **深度学习模型**:尽管OpenCV内置的传统算法足以实现基本的人脸检测和辨识任务,但现代系统往往依赖于FaceNet、MTCNN或SSD这样的深度学习框架来获得更高的准确率。这些模型在大量数据集上训练后能够提供更精确的识别结果。 5. **签到考勤逻辑**:每次成功完成人脸识别后,系统将记录时间戳以实现自动签到功能,并具备异常处理机制如重复签入、未识别人脸等情况下的应对措施。 6. **数据库管理**:为了存储和维护员工信息及考勤记录,项目可能采用SQLite或MySQL等数据库管理系统来进行数据的长期保存与分析统计工作。 7. **用户界面**:不同版本(例如V1.0和V2.0)可能会包含前端UI改进。开发人员可以使用Tkinter、PyQt或者wxPython这样的库来创建交互式签到界面。 8. **README.md文件**: 该文档包含了项目介绍、安装说明、操作指南以及开发者信息等内容,帮助用户更好地理解和利用该项目。 9. **requirements.txt**:此文本列明了运行项目所需的所有Python包及其版本号,确保其他开发人员能够轻松地复制并验证环境配置。 通过以上技术的融合应用,本系统旨在提高工作效率的同时减少人为错误,并保证考勤记录的高度准确性。
  • Python
    优质
    Python人脸识别考勤系统是一款基于Python编程语言开发的应用程序,利用先进的人脸识别技术实现自动化考勤管理。该系统通过面部图像捕捉与分析,精确记录员工出勤情况,提升办公效率和安全性。 Python人脸识别考勤系统仅供学习交流及一切非盈利用途,禁止商用。
  • Python上课源码介绍
    优质
    本项目提供了一套基于Python的人脸识别技术实现的课堂考勤解决方案,包括完整源代码和详细文档。通过高效准确地记录学生出勤情况,提高教学管理效率。 Python实现基于人脸识别的上课考勤系统源码及项目介绍:此考勤签到系统是在人脸识别陌生人报警系统的二次开发基础上构建而成。整个项目使用Python编程语言编写,并利用OpenCV框架进行人脸检测与摄像头硬件操作,同时借助OpenCV工具包处理图片数据。用户界面则通过pyqt5库来实现。 该系统涵盖了从学生信息录入、面部特征采集到训练模型的全过程功能,包括多条件查询和修改学生记录、批量删除选项以及人脸识别追踪签到等核心模块。此外,它还支持生成并导出Excel格式的签到表格以供进一步分析使用。 根据具体的功能需求,本系统被划分为三个主要部分进行开发: 1. 录入端:负责数据导入与处理; 2. 管理端:用于执行学生信息及人脸数据库的相关操作(如增删改查)和模型训练任务; 3. 监控端:专注于实时的人脸识别验证以及考勤签到功能。